Authors list in My Books

Am I the only one who "corrects" the metadata for authors so that the displayed name matches the sort name, namely make it LastName, FirstName?

In the Authors list in My Books it seems to think that that comma separates multiple authors so every author is in that list at least twice.

Is there any way to fix this?

In earlier firmware versions (up to 3.19.5761, maybe some of the early 4.x.x versions?) the ampersand '&' ligature and the word 'and' were used to separate multiple authors' names, so a comma could be used to write the individual name in "Last, First" format without problems.

But then later they changed the multiple name separator to comma, and so now the "Last, First" format doesn't work properly.

I think the Authors tab was added about the same time they changed the name separator to comma or shortly after, so I don't think there is any firmware version where the Authors tab works properly with names in "Last, First" format.

So in short you can downgrade to an earlier firmware (without the Authors tab) and use names in either "First Last" or "Last, First" format, but if you want to run the current firmware then you have to either use the "First Last" format or else live with the problems caused by the comma being treated as a name separator.


Edit: Some examples might make it clearer what I mean:

In earlier firmware versions all of these author name formats were supported:
* Joe Bloggs and Jane Smith
* Joe Bloggs & Jane Smith
* Joe Bloggs, Jane Smith
* Bloggs, Joe and Smith, Jane
* Bloggs, Joe & Smith, Jane

But in later firmware versions only one format is supported:
* Joe Bloggs, Jane Smith

As a rule, it works better to store the author name as the natural version of the name. Or whatever you would expect to see on the cover of the book. Use the author sort for the alternate version. You can use either in a template when saving the book or in a metadata plugboard. And if you prefer to see the sort version in calibre, you can display that instead.
